Escrow Agent (Treuhänder)

An independent person of trust (usually a lawyer or notary) who holds the purchase price and releases it only once the agreed safeguards are in place.

In brief

In a property purchase the buyer does not pay the price directly to the seller but into the escrow account. The escrow agent releases the funds only once unencumbered ownership is secured, for example once the ranking order is in place and the discharge of encumbrances by the mortgagees is assured.

Lawyer-administered escrow is safeguarded through the electronic escrow system and escrow institutions. It protects both sides: the seller receives the money, the buyer an unencumbered register sheet.
